SUNDAY 8/21
I missed the closing ceremonies. DenFur initially announced on Telegram and Twitter that they had 2,961 attendees, 522 fursuits in the parade and raised a very impressive $158,240 for the con charity. However, those announcements were later deleted. (UPDATE 8/26) The official total released was $21,827.65.
I went to the con's feedback panel expecting the con chair to avoid addressing certain issues. To my surprise, the chair was upfront and honest about the staffing, safety and discrimination issues that happened before the con. I am glad there were promises made to do better next year. I just hope the con actually takes these steps because, as the saying goes, actions speak louder than words.
